FAQs

Do I need to bring my own equipment?

In most cases, the lesson includes the use of boots, boards, and bindings, but you should check the specific terms for your chosen location as some items may vary.

Can I choose my own level for the lesson?

Yes, it is vital to state your experience level at the time of booking so the instructors can place you in the appropriate group.

Are there lessons available for experts?

Some locations specialize in beginner lessons only; please verify if your chosen location offers advanced-level instruction before booking.

Why do I need to arrive 30 minutes early?

The early arrival is to allow time for equipment collection, checking, and the mandatory safety briefing before hitting the slopes.

What should I wear for the lesson?

Wear comfortable, warm, moisture-wicking clothing and long socks. Check your specific location details to see if they provide additional gear like hats or scarves.

Troubleshooting

Difficulty securing bindings

Clear any packed snow or debris from the binding ratchets and ensure your boot heel is fully seated in the binding cup before tightening.

Boots feel uncomfortable or too loose

Ask the staff for a half-size adjustment or ensure your socks are pulled up smoothly without wrinkles inside the boot liner.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

To ensure your lesson goes smoothly, arrive at the facility at least 30 minutes before your scheduled start time. This buffer is essential for the fitting process, where you will be paired with boots and a board appropriate for your height and weight. Always communicate your true experience level during the booking process to avoid being placed in a group that is too advanced or too basic for your needs. If the location provides apparel like hats and scarves, ensure they are dry and secure before heading to the slope. For your own comfort, wear moisture-wicking layers and long socks to prevent chafing inside the rental boots.
